Objective To study the chemical constituents and anti-inflammatory activities of medicinal insect Vespa velutina auraria.Methods The compounds were isolated and purified by silica gel,Sephadex LH-20 and semi-preparative liquid chromatography,while the structures of compounds were characterized and analyzed by nuclear magnetic resonance(NMR)technique.The mouse macrophage RAW264.7 inflammation model was induced by lipopolysaccharide(LPS)combined with interferon γ(IFN-γ),the effects of extracts and monomers on the mRNA expression of inflammatory factors were investigated.Results A total of 16 compounds were isolated from ethyl acetate fractions and identified as catechol hydroquinone(1),4-hydroxybenzaldehyde(2),methyl 3-(4-hydroxyphenyl)propionate(3),4-hydroxyphenethy acetate(4),3,4-dihydroxy-phenethyl alcohol(5),3,4-dihydroxyphenyl ethanol ketone(6),3,4-dihydroxy-benzoic acid(7),divesamides A(8),methyl-2-(2-hydroxy-propionyloxy)propionate(9),4-methoxybenzyl alcohol(10),3,4-dihydroxy-benzoic methyl ester(11),α-ethyl glucoside(12),papuline(13),N-acetyl-dopamine(14),2-(4-methylphenyl)ethanol(15),thymine(16).The alcohol extracts,ethyl acetate fractions,n-butanol fractions and water fractions of V.velutina auraria could effectively reduce the relative expression of iNOS gene of cellular inflammatory factor in RAW264.7 induced by LPS+IFN-γ when the administration concentration of ethyl acetate,n-butanol and water fractions was 300 μg/mL.Compounds 2,3,5,6,9-11 inhibited the expression of TNF-α mRNA in RAW264.7 cells induced by LPS combined with IFN-γ(P<0.01).Conclusion The alcoholic extracts and different polar parts of V.velutina auraria can reduce the expression of iNOS in inflammatory cells and have some anti-inflammatory effects.Compounds 1-16 are isolated and identified from the ethyl acetate portion of V.velutina auraria for the first time,of which 2,3,5,6,9-11 may be potential active monomers.
